HUTT & PETONE NEWS.
■•' (From Out Soecial 06rr«eponfionU It is probable that.'a vigorous agita-' tiori will shortly be tnado against the practice, of riding horses . along the; Pctone water-front. Last Sunday d. great crowd of adults and children were on.the foreshore, when two horsemen rodo through them. .Similar occurrences happen frequently. - A Petono suggests that a "ladies' area" be marked off on the Potpno beach. , If an area from Bay Street-to Queen Street were apportioned to women only, the-present nuisance of loungers hanging round would be at an end. The . author of these suggestion states that ho lias remonstrated with many of these loungers, but without success. '■ . ..,.'■- The Petonc Rugby League will 1 hold its annual outing at Day's Bay on February 8. Sub-committees have been set up to deal with the details. A' special meeting of tho Petb'ne District High School Committee" will' be held on Wednesday evening to consider matters' connected with the appointment of two assistant teacher's. '■ The public schools in the Hutt■■ Valley re-open to-day. Yesterday the College of tho Sacred ' Heart, Lower Huttv commenced its first term.
